Information on EC 1.14.14.83 - geraniol 8-hydroxylase

IUBMB Comments
A cytochrome P-450 (heme thiolate) protein found in plants. Also hydroxylates nerol and citronellol, cf. EC 1.14.14.84, linalool 8-monooxygenase. The recommended numbering of geraniol gives 8-hydroxygeraniol as the product rather than 10-hydroxygeraniol as used by references 1-3. See prenol nomenclature {iupac/misc/prenol#p1::Pr-1}. The cloned enzyme also catalysed, but less efficiently, the 3'-hydroxylation of naringenin (cf. EC 1.14.14.82, flavonoid 3'-monooxygenase) .

geraniol + [reduced NADPH-hemoprotein reductase] + O2 = (6E)-8-hydroxygeraniol + [oxidized NADPH-hemoprotein reductase] + H2O
